Yaw Min Gyi’s latest watering hole is an ideal place for sports fans to enjoy some beer and barbecue, writes Anabelle Ayma and Lou De Bruycker.

The Social House (Kitchen & Tap) – Yangon offers a motto: “Eat, drink, be social.” And that shines through, especially in the evenings.

The place is spotless and has a modern design, with fun quotes written on the walls and dream catchers hanging from the ceiling. Three TVs and a projector screen the latest sports, while the background music is fairly quiet and Western.

Inspired by German beer gardens, the owner wanted to create an open space for beer and barbecue that brings people together on the same big tables. It also offers a “big share plate” so you can taste with your friends all the different dishes on the menu.

The roomy restaurant, which has a terrace and Wi-Fi, serves a wide range of barbequed meats including deep-fried chicken wings (4,000 kyats) and thighs (3,500 kyats) which come with six dipping sauces.

Another specialty is the yakitori (skewer) chicken thigh and green onion (900 kyats) and beef with garlic butter (1,400 kyats).

The drinks menu has a diverse choice of beers on tap (from 1,500 kyats) to bottled domestics (from 2,000 kyats) and imports (from 2,500 kyats). Juices and fancy drinks (from 4,800 kyats) are on the menu plus some desserts are in the pipeline.
